Description

Cannubi - Barolo DOCG

 The Cannubi Barolo DOCG is made in Italy. a superior class wine produced exclusively with Nebbiolo grapes, coming from one of the most important; renowned and prestigious MGA (Additional Geographic Mentions) of Barolo, the Cannubi.

Production details

The vineyards face south and are located at an altitude of 290-320 meters above sea level, covering an area of ​​1.30 hectares. The land is composed of clayey calcareous marls, slightly sandy, which contribute to the distinctive character of this wine. The vine training system is a unique one. Modified Guyot (arch), with a density of of 4,000 vines per hectare.

Technical notes

The harvest takes place in the first ten days of October. Natural fermentation, without added yeasts, takes place in cement tanks for about 12 days, with temperatures ranging from 22 to 29 °C, followed by submerged cap maceration for about 40-50 days at 29 °C. After racking, malolactic fermentation begins for 15 days at a constant temperature of 22 °C. The wine then matures for 4 years in 4500 liter Slavonian oak and French oak barrels, and ages for a further 6 months in the bottle.

The Cannubi vineyard

The Cannubi vineyard, formed about 12 million years ago by sedimentation from the Po Valley, is one of the most famous vineyards in the world. the most cru; famous and renowned of Barolo, already mentioned; in historical documents dating back to the 1700s. of terroir, made up of large marl-clayey calcareous soils, and a favorable climate make this hill one of the most dedicated to the cultivation of vines in the world. The wines from Cannubi are among those of greater elegance and longevity; throughout the Barolo wine scene.

Food pairings

This Barolo goes perfectly with important dishes, such as traditional Piedmontese meat main courses. On a world culinary journey, this wine goes well with goulash from Eastern Europe, Japanese grilled meat (yakiniku), such as beef, and in the United States with cuts of beef ribs, for example in onion stout beef recipe. Despite its imposing nature, this wine also lends itself to a simple, but special, toast.

The recommended serving temperature for this wine is; of 18° C, in order to better appreciate all its facets.
